Yard erosion repair services focus on restoring and stabilizing landscapes that have been compromised by soil loss, water runoff, or other environmental factors. These services typically involve reshaping the affected areas, installing erosion control measures such as retaining walls, silt fences, or grading solutions, and reinforcing the soil to prevent future damage. The goal is to create a stable, visually appealing yard that maintains its integrity over time, even during heavy rains or seasonal changes.
Erosion in yards can lead to significant problems, including uneven ground, loss of valuable topsoil, and damage to landscaping features like gardens, pathways, or lawns. Unchecked erosion may also threaten the stability of nearby structures or cause water drainage issues that lead to pooling or flooding. Yard erosion repair services help address these concerns by correcting the underlying issues, improving drainage, and implementing preventative measures to reduce the likelihood of recurrence.

Repair Costs - The cost for yard erosion repair services typ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the extent of erosion and size of the area. For smaller patches, prices may be closer to $1,000, while larger projects can exceed $5,000. Variations depend on local contractor rates and specific site conditions.
Material Expenses - Material costs for erosion repair, such as soil stabilization and reinforcement materials, generally fall between $200 and $1,500. The exact expense varies based on the type and quantity of materials needed for the project. Prices are influenced by local supplier rates and project scope.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for yard erosion repair services typically range from $500 to $3,000. The total depends on the project size, complexity, and local labor rates. Larger or more complex repairs tend to increase overall costs.
Additional Factors - Extra costs may include site preparation, grading, or drainage improvements,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total. These costs vary with project specifics and local contractor pricing in Hendersonville, TN, and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Drainage System Installation is often part of erosion repair, as proper drainage prevents water from pooling and eroding soil in the yard. Professionals can design and install drainage solutions tailored to specific landscape needs.
Retaining Wall Construction provides a physical barrier to control soil movement and prevent erosion on sloped properties. Experienced contractors can build durable retaining walls suited to the yard’s terrain.
Soil Stabilization involves techniques and materials that help hold soil in place, reducing erosion risks. Local service providers can implement stabilization methods suitable for various yard conditions.
Landscape Grading services help recontour the yard to promote proper water flow and minimize erosion. Skilled contractors can reshape the landscape for better runoff management.
Erosion Control Matting involves installing mats or blankets that protect soil during recovery and prevent further erosion. Contractors can recommend and install appropriate erosion control coverings for the yard.

What causes yard erosion? Yard erosion can result from heavy rainfall, poor drainage, or lack of ground stabilization, leading to soil displacement and uneven terrain.
How can erosion damage my yard? Erosion can cause loss of topsoil, uneven ground, damaged landscaping, and increased risk of further soil instability.
What repair options are available for yard erosion? Local service providers may offer solutions such as grading, installing retaining walls, adding ground cover, or improving drainage systems.
How long does yard erosion repair typically take? Repair duration varies depending on the extent of erosion and chosen methods; a consultation with a local contractor can provide more specific timelines.
Is yard erosion repair suitable for all types of yards? Most yards affected by erosion can benefit from repair services, though the approach may differ based on soil type, slope, and landscape features.
